In the Drama and Performing Arts classroom, we cultivate the cognitive skills of language, speech, communication, problem-solving, critical thinking, and quick decision-making. We regularly perform for an internal audience of peers and biannually for the whole Lakeside School community.  

Collaborative teamwork is celebrated, expected, and encouraged in a supportive, engaging, and fully inclusive environment.

Some children learn best through an adapted curriculum. This could be for many reasons, such as showing gifted potential, needing support in learning languages, or needing extra creative teaching methods for literacy and numeracy. I believe every child should enjoy school and value their own progress, regardless of their challenges.
